How much does it cost to rent a home in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,843 | $950 | $3,300 |
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,097 | $900 | $4,300 |
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,802 | $1,300 | $5,500 |
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,835 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,671 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
|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,800 | $2,800 | $2,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k
What type of rentals are currently available in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k?
There are currently 929 Apartments for Rent in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k, PA with pricing that ranges from $400 to $6,499. There are also 455 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k ranging from $550 to $12,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k ranges from $550 to $12,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,651.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Northwest Philadelphia/Manayunk range from $1,350 to $5,280,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$900 to $4,300.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,920.
